Only 4 Simple Ingredients
One of the greatest appeals of this recipe is its simplicity. You only need four readily available ingredients to create these incredibly flavorful bites. Each ingredient plays a crucial role in achieving that perfect sweet, salty, and spicy balance.
- Brown Sugar: This is the key to the irresistible sweet and caramelized glaze. Packed light brown sugar is preferred for its moist texture and rich, molasses-like flavor, which complements the savory bacon beautifully.
- Cayenne Pepper: A touch of cayenne pepper introduces a subtle warmth and a delightful kick, balancing the sweetness of the brown sugar. Feel free to double the amount if you prefer a spicier appetizer, or omit it entirely if you want a purely sweet and savory flavor.
- Bacon: The star of the show! Use regular or thin-cut bacon for the best results. Thick-cut bacon can take too long to crisp up and may not wrap as neatly around the little smokies, leading to uneven cooking. Maple-flavored bacon is an excellent choice for an extra layer of sweetness and aroma.
- Little Smokies: These miniature sausages are the perfect bite-sized base for our appetizer. Any brand of cocktail sausages will work, typically found in the refrigerated section of your grocery store.
Pro Tips for Perfect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ies
Achieving perfectly crispy bacon and a beautifully caramelized glaze is easy with these helpful tips and tricks. Follow these suggestions to ensure your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ies are the talk of the party.
- Enhance the Sweetness: For those who adore a truly sweet and sticky glaze, don’t hesitate to sprinkle a little extra brown sugar directly onto the bacon-wrapped smokies just before they go into the oven. This creates an even more caramelized and glossy finish.
- Choose the Right Bacon: This tip is crucial. Always opt for regular or thin-cut bacon. Thick-cut bacon, while delicious, can be challenging to wrap tightly around the small sausages and often requires longer cooking times to become crispy, which can lead to the little smokies overcooking or the brown sugar burning.

- Ensure Crispy Bacon: If your bacon isn’t as crispy as you’d like after the initial baking time, don’t fret! Simply turn on your oven’s broiler for a few minutes. Keep a very close eye on them, as bacon can go from perfectly crispy to burnt in a matter of seconds under the broiler. This quick burst of high heat will ensure that irresistible crispiness.
- Experiment with Bacon Flavors: While classic plain bacon works wonderfully, don’t be afraid to try different flavors. Maple-flavored bacon is a personal favorite for this recipe, as it enhances the sweetness and adds a delightful aromatic quality. Hickory-smoked or applewood-smoked bacon can also add interesting depth.
- Prepare Your Baking Sheet: This step is non-negotiable! Line your baking sheet generously with aluminum foil or parchment paper. Better yet, use disposable foil sheet pans if you have them. The combination of melting brown sugar and rendered bacon grease creates a notoriously sticky mess that can be very difficult to clean. Lining the pan ensures easy cleanup, allowing you more time to enjoy your delicious creation.
- Make Ahead Option: These appetizers are fantastic for advanced preparation. You can assemble them the night before your event, storing them covered in the refrigerator. When ready to serve, simply pop them into the oven about 30 minutes before your guests arrive, fresh and warm.
- Keep Them Warm: If you need to keep a larger batch warm for an extended period, a slow cooker or crock pot is your best friend. After baking, transfer the cooked bacon-wrapped smokies to the crock pot. Pour any accumulated juices and glaze from the baking pan over them. You can add a little extra maple syrup or a tablespoon of brown sugar to maintain moisture and flavor. Set the crock pot to the “warm” or “low” setting, and they’ll stay perfectly warm and delicious for hours.
- Adjust Spice Levels: The recipe calls for a modest amount of cayenne pepper, which provides a gentle warmth. If you prefer a bolder, spicier kick, feel free to double or even triple the amount of cayenne pepper. For an alternative spice, a pinch of smoked paprika can add a nice smoky depth without too much heat.

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ies Recipe

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ies are an incredibly easy and popular appetizer requiring only 4 ingredients. These little sausages are wrapped in savory bacon, coated with a delightful mixture of brown sugar and cayenne pepper, then baked to sweet, salty, and spicy perfection.
Equipment
-
Rimmed Baking Sheet
Ingredients
- 3/4 cup packed light brown sugar
- 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(adjust to taste)
- 1 pound bacon, (regular or thin-cut, each slice cut into thirds)
- 1 (14-ounce) package little smokies
Instructions
-
Pre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it (175°C). Line a large rimmed baking sheet with aluminum foil or parchment paper for easy cleanup. Alternatively, you can use a disposable foil sheet pan.
-
In a shallow dish or on a plate, combine the brown sugar and cayenne pepper, mixing them thoroughly.
-
Take one little smoky sausage and wrap a piece of cut bacon tightly around it. Secure the bacon with a wooden toothpick. Roll the bacon-wrapped smoky in the brown sugar and cayenne mixture, ensuring it’s evenly coated. Place it seam-side down on your prepared baking sheet. Repeat this process for all the remaining little smokies. For an extra sweet crust, you can sprinkle a little more brown sugar on top of each one before baking.
-
Bake for 30 to 35 minutes, or until the bacon is crispy and the sugar has caramelized to a beautiful golden-brown glaze.
-
If the bacon isn’t as crispy as you desire after baking, briefly turn on your oven’s broiler for a few minutes. Watch them carefully to prevent burning; bacon can crisp up very quickly under the broiler. Serve warm and enjoy!

Frequently Asked Questions About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ies
Here are some common questions and answers to help you make the best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ies possible:
- Can I use turkey bacon instead of pork bacon? Yes, you can. However, turkey bacon tends to be leaner and may not crisp up as well or render as much fat, which contributes to the glaze. You might need to adjust baking times slightly.
- What if I don’t have toothpicks? Toothpicks are highly recommended to secure the bacon while it cooks. Without them, the bacon may unwrap. If you absolutely can’t use toothpicks, try to wrap the bacon as tightly as possible and place the seam side down on the baking sheet, hoping the heat helps it seal.
- Can I make these in an air fryer? Absolutely! Air fryers are excellent for crispy bacon. Preheat your air fryer to 375°F (190°C). Arrange the bacon-wrapped smokies in a single layer without overcrowding the basket. Cook for 10-15 minutes, flipping halfway, until the bacon is crispy and the glaze is bubbly.
- How do I store leftovers? Leftover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
- How do I reheat them? For best results, reheat them in a preheated oven at 300°F (150°C) for about 10-15 minutes, or until warmed through and the bacon is crispy again. An air fryer also works great for reheating, typically at 350°F (175°C) for 5-7 minutes.
- Can I freeze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ies? While you can freeze the cooked appetizers, the bacon might lose some of its crispiness upon reheating. It’s generally best to enjoy them fresh or store in the fridge.
- Are there any variations I can try? Definitely! For a different flavor profile, consider adding a dash of smoked paprika, garlic powder, or a pinch of chili powder to the brown sugar mixture. A drizzle of maple syrup or a touch of Dijon mustard can also be added before baking for an extra layer of flavor.
Serving Suggestions
While Bacon Wrapped Little Smokies are a stellar stand-alone appetizer, they also pair beautifully with other complementary dishes and dips. Serve them hot off the baking sheet for the ultimate experience. Consider having a small bowl of spicy mustard, BBQ sauce, or a creamy ranch dip on the side for guests who enjoy extra dipping options. For a well-rounded appetizer spread, include a fresh veggie platter, some cheese and crackers, or other savory bites from our game day recipes list. For drinks, these pair wonderfully with craft beers, a light-bodied red wine, or even sparkling cider for a non-alcoholic option.
